Transaction 955f6a2ae92c715f755608f8e2b7675b1621899752d732af903cdcf89f40130e
1 Input
1 Output
-
955f6a2ae92c715f755608f8e2b7675b1621899752d732af903cdcf89f40130e:0
- value
- 5099228
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5441b56cb8f14c1c783820174ea5941488b4877 OP_EQUAL
- address
- 3JDTpQcnjjuG7e3a1VxMFYzRPeWxJoy8VM